<italic toggle="yes">Clostridium difficile</italic> Lipoprotein GerS Is Required for Cortex Modification and Thus Spore Germination

ABSTRACT Clostridium difficile, also known as Clostridioides difficile, is a Gram-positive, spore-forming bacterium that is a leading cause of antibiotic-associated diarrhea.
